Hiro Ramen Coming to Center City East
Posted by Aubrey Nagle on July 24th, 2012
Philadelphia really needs another ramen place, right? Lucky for us yet another is opening up at 1102 Chestnut called Hiro Ramen House. While not much is known about their opening Hiro seems to already be tackling a web presence. Their fancy website shows some pretty bowls of ramen and a menu of four choices (including something called the Gates of Hell) while their Facebook page says they will be opening in August. Their Twitter account is tweet-less for now but maybe some time soon an opening date will appear. Until then we’ll just be happy that more noddles are coming.
